Potassium chlorate, when heated in the presence of a catalyst, MnO2, generates oxygen gas and potassium chloride solid residue. If the oxygen generated by completely heating 5.00 g of potassium chlorate is trapped in a container over water, where the total pressure of the trapped gases is 1.00 bar, what will be the volume of the trapped gases? Assume a temperature of 25oC. You will need to refer to a table of water vapor pressures at various temperatures in order to complete these problem (e.g., CRC tables). [V = 1.567 L]
